Abstract
We studied membrane currents in granulosa cells (GC), immediately after collection or after variable culture time in the everted-follicle wall or in the monolayer.
GC in both systems express an inward calcium current (I Ca) with T-type kinetics and voltage dependence. GC in the everted-follicle culture express an outward potassium current (I K) kinetics, which remains unchanged during three days in culture. I K has delayed-rectifier kinetics, but is insensitive to TEA, 4-AP and apamine. GC in monolayer culture develop a new, inactivating delayed-rectifier potassium current (I nK), which progressively dominates as cells advance from day one to day three in culture. A similar I nK was recorded in large luteal cells. A possible link between luteinization and the appearance of I nK is hypothesized.
